A line passes through the point (2, 3) and has a slope of -8. Write an equation for this line.

Answer:

y = -8x+19

Step-by-step explanation:

The slope intercept form of a line is

y = mx+b  where m is the slope and b is the y intercept

y = -8x+b

Substitute the point into the equation

3 = -8(2)+b

3 = -16+b

Add 16 to each side

3+16 = b

19 = b

y = -8x+19
